About the Art Directors Guild:
The Art Directors Guild (IATSE Local 800) represents nearly 2,000 members who work throughout the United States, Canada and the rest of the world in film, television and theater as Production Designers, Art Directors, and Assistant Art Directors; Scenic, Title and Graphic Artists; Illustrators and Matte Artists; Set Designers and Model Makers and Previs Artists. Established in 1937, ADG’s ongoing activities include a Film Society; an annual Awards Banquet, a creative/technology community (5D: The Future of Immersive Design) and Membership Directory; a bimonthly craft magazine (Perspective); and extensive technology-training programs, creative workshops and craft and art exhibitions. WINNERS FOR EXCELLENCE IN PRODUCTION DESIGN FOR A FEATURE FILM IN 2011:
Period Film
HUGO
Production Designer: Dante Ferretti
Fantasy Film
HARRY POTTER AND THE DEATHLY HALLOWS PART 2
Production Designer: Stuart Craig
Contemporary Film
THE GIRL WITH THE DRAGON TATTOO
Production Designer: Donald Graham Burt
WINNERS FOR EXCELLENCE IN PRODUCTION DESIGN IN TELEVISION FOR 2011:
One-Hour Single Camera Television Series
BOARDWALK EMPIRE -- Episode: 21
Production Designer: Bill Groom
Television Movie or Mini-Series
MILDRED PIERCE
Production Designer: Mark Friedberg
Episode of a Half Hour Single-Camera Television Series
MODERN FAMILY -- Episode: Express Christmas
Production Designer: Richard Berg
Episode of a Multi-Camera, Variety, or Unscripted Series
SATURDAY NIGHT LIVE -- Episode: Host Justin Timberlake and Musical Guest – Lady Gaga
Production Designer: Keith Ian Raywood, Eugene Lee, Leo Yoshimura, N. Joseph De Tullio
Awards, Music, or Game Shows
83rd ANNUAL ACADEMY AWARDS
Production Designer: Steve Bass
